Cost of Sickness Absence
The Chartered Institute of Personnel and Development survey in 2009 found the average cost of sickness absence per year is now £692 per employee, with each employee taking an average of 7.4 days off each year.

Across the UK absence costs the economy £17.3 billion per year.

Their annual poll concluded that the provision of OH is now recognised by employers, across all sectors, as one of the most important weapons in their armoury for tackling both short and long term absence.
